Highest Education Level
Fraud Specialists in Saint Augustine, FL offer the following education background
Bachelor's Degree
42.7%
Master's Degree
18.1%
High School or GED
14.6%
Associate's Degree
12.1%
Vocational Degree or Certification
7.9%
Some College
2.3%
Doctorate Degree
1.8%
Some High School
0.5%
Average Work Experience
Here's a breakdown of the number of years' experience offered by Fraud Specialists in Saint Augustine, FL
2-4 years
48.0%
4-6 years
20.0%
1-2 years
12.0%
8-10 years
12.0%
10+ years
4.0%
None
4.0%
